Dinamiko transakcije s kriptovalutami je lahko nekoliko težavno razumeti, saj ne delujejo na enak način kot tradicionalne digitalne transakcije. Številni elementi igrajo vlogo pri kateri koli transakciji s kriptovalutami, vključno z mempoolom. Toda kaj je mempool in kakšno vlogo ima v vaših kripto transakcijah?
Kako deluje kripto transakcija?
Da bi razumeli položaj mempoolov v kripto transakcijah, poglejmo kratek pregled celotnega procesa. V verigi blokov se izvede transakcija, ki jo nato preverijo rudarji ali validatorji, tako da omrežje ostane varno.
Pomembno je omeniti, da vse transakcije s kriptovalutami ne delujejo na popolnoma enak način, ker se vse verige blokov razlikujejo med seboj. Na primer, lahko uporabite algoritem proof of stake, drugi pa uporablja proof of work. Eden lahko zahteva več potrditev, drugi pa manj.
Vzemimo za primer Bitcoin. Ta veriga blokov zahteva najmanj šest potrditev na transakcijo in a dokončanje transakcije lahko traja nekaj časa zaradi velikega povpraševanja uporabnikov. Ethereum na drugi strani zahteva najmanj sedem potrditev.
Poleg tega ima vsaka veriga blokov različno število vozlišč, kar vpliva na število prisotnih mempoolov. Morda boste ugotovili, da nekateri mempoole imenujejo "mempool". Čeprav je to v redu, ko se nanaša na a določenega mempoola, je pomembno vedeti, da ni enega velikega mempoola, ki bi se razprostiral po celotnem blockchain. Namesto tega ima vsako vozlišče svoj mempool. Torej, več vozlišč kot ima omrežje, več mempoolov bo.
A v vsakem primeru igrajo mempooli pomembno vlogo pri transakcijah s kriptovalutami. Torej, kakšen je njihov namen?
Kaj je Mempool?
Mempool (različica "pomnilniškega bazena") deluje kot nekakšna čakalnica za čakajoče transakcije s kriptovalutami. Kot je bilo že navedeno, se kripto transakcije ne izvajajo in dokončajo hkrati. Namesto tega jih mora za obdelavo preveriti omrežje vozlišč verige blokov. To lahko traja nekaj časa, zato mora čakajoča transakcija nekam oditi, medtem ko čaka na preverjanje. To "nekje" je mempool.
Vse transakcije v verigi blokov morajo vstopiti v mempool za potrditev. Znotraj mempoola lahko vozlišče shrani informacije o nepotrjenih transakcijah. Odvisno od strojne opreme, ki se uporablja za zagon vozlišča, se lahko velikost njegovega mempoola razlikuje. Vrhunska strojna oprema lahko pogosto shrani večje količine podatkov, medtem ko ima bolj osnovna strojna oprema nižjo zmogljivost shranjevanja mempool.
Ko ima omrežje visoko povpraševanje po transakcijah, se mempooli zamašijo, zaradi česar so transakcijski časi daljši, kot pogosto vidimo na verigah blokov z omejeno razširljivost, kot je Bitcoin. Omrežja z dosledno varnostno kopiranimi mempooli imajo lahko na splošno tudi višje stroške.
Ko dani mempool doseže svojo zmogljivost shranjevanja, bo rudar ali validator začel dajati prednost transakcijam z najvišjimi provizijami, saj je to njihova finančna spodbuda. Če torej izberete najnižjo možno provizijo za svojo transakcijo s kriptovaluto, obstaja velika verjetnost, da boste na koncu čakali dlje, da jo preverite.
Nekateri trgovci v verigi blokov Bitcoin se odločijo za uporabo transakcijski pospeševalci upajmo, da skrajšajo čas, ko njihova transakcija čaka v mempoolu (čeprav to ni zajamčeno pravno sredstvo). V tem scenariju bo posameznik bodisi ponovno predvajal svojo transakcijo, da bi rudarje opomnil, da je še v teku, bodisi plačal pristojbino za prednostno razvrstitev svoje transakcije.
Takoj ko je transakcija potrjena, zapusti mempool in se nadomesti z drugo čakajočo transakcijo. Transakcije, ki ne dosegajo minimalne provizije, bodo takoj odstranjene iz mempoola in ne bodo obdelane.
Toda mempooli niso ostali brez kritik. Nekateri verjamejo, da finančni element, povezan z mempooli, ustvarja nepošteno prednost za premožnejše uporabnike. To je vidno tudi v rudarski industriji, kjer imajo tisti, ki imajo sredstva za vlaganje v dražjo strojno opremo, pogosto več možnosti, da rudarijo priložnost in požanjejo nagrado.
Mempooli so ključni pri preverjanju kripto transakcij
Znotraj omrežja kripto blockchain so mempooli neprecenljivi. Brez teh baz podatkov si vozlišča ne bi mogla ogledati čakajočih transakcij in bolje organizirati procesa rudarjenja ali potrjevanja. Čeprav mempooli niso brez težav, tvorijo hrbtenico modela kripto transakcij.